Wakefield Inclusion Special Educational Needs and Disabilities Support Service (WISENDSS) is seeking a Specialist Learning Support Assistant to work within our Vision Impairment Resource at Crofton Academy.
We are looking for a motivated individual to provide excellent support to our visually impaired pupils within the resource base and mainstream classes.
Key qualities include:
1. Experience working with children with special educational needs and disabilities, particularly visual impairment (training will be provided for the right candidate)
2. Good communication skills
3. Ability to work as part of a team and show initiative
4. Commitment to helping children learn and progress
5. Optimism, sense of humour, and problem-solving skills
6. Willingness to learn
7. Excellent work ethic
This post is for term-time, 32.5 hours per week.
